This memorial is located on a rock ledge overlooking the area where three firefighters lost their lives battling the Cart Creek Fire on July 16, 1977.

Gene Campbell (57), Dave Noel (35), Dwight Hodgkinson (25) were trapped by flames and killed due to a sudden wind shift. This memorial, placed at a stone overlook that was constructed with a view of the area burned by the fire, is a short hike along a groomed trail in the Firefighters Memorial Campground in the Ashley National Forest near Flaming Gorge Reservoir in northeastern Utah.
